HAMPTON, Va. (WAVY) — A man is facing charges for allegedly punching a Hampton police officer and trying to disarm another during an arrest.

Hampton police say officers were called to a 7-Eleven on Hardy Cash Drive around 3:30 p.m. Wednesday for an unauthorized use of an automobile complaint.

Police say the suspect, 19-year-old Randy Todd Roberts Jr., began pushing the officers when they tried to detain him. Roberts allegedly punched one of the officers in the face and tried to grab another’s gun.

Police say Roberts bit a third officer who arrived on scene. None of the officers were seriously injured.

Roberts was charged with unauthorized use of an automobile, obstruction of justice, three counts of assault on a law enforcement officer and attempting to disarm a law enforcement officer.
